Super Mario Party has been a fans favorite for some time now. Nintendo Switch owners can finally enjoy the game on the hybrid console beginning at midnight October 5th. The game features 80 mini games that can be enjoyed with up to 4 players in local multiplayer. Nintendo also introduced an online mode for the first time. Players will be able to compete against each others online using a special multiplayer mode.

The online mode, also called Mariothon, will feature a round of 5 randommomly selected mini games, in which each player will have to compete for the highest score in order to win the match. Although Super Mario Party does not feature a full online mode in which the entire game board can be played online, it still is the first online component in any Super Mario Party ever released.

About Super Mario Party

The original 4-player Mario Party series board game mode that fans love is back, and your friends and family are invited to the party! Freely walk the board: choose where to move, which Dice Block to roll, and how to win the most Stars in skill-based minigames. Wait till you see the 2 vs 2 mode with grid-based maps, the creative uses of the console, and the series’ first online minigame mode!

Test your skills in sets of five minigames with the new mode, Mariothon, and see how you stack up against players across the globe in Online Mariothon*. Whether you’re pedaling tricycles, flipping meat, or who knows what else, you’ll use Joy-Con™ controllers in clever ways across 80 new minigames; some are all-out free-for-alls, others are 2 vs 2, or even 1 vs 3! Toad’s Rec Room lets you pair up two Nintendo Switch™ systems**, which you’ll lay side-by-side on a flat surface like a real tabletop game. That way you can play a mini baseball game, battle tanks in custom arenas, or even see who can match the most bananas by repositioning the systems however you see fit!
